The Judge WANTS you to take them to the applicable law and be able to explain why you think it is a non POFA case. That will make it easy for him/her to find in your favour on a clear point of law.
Henry Greenslade POPLA Annual Report 2015 section about keeper liability, not the entire report but maybe the first page and his introduction as well, to give it context.PRIVATE 'PCN'? DON'T PAY BUT DON'T IGNORE IT (except N.Ireland).
